Across cultures, the forearm has long symbolized strength, spirituality, and belonging. Ancient Egyptian tattoos marked rites of passage, while Polynesian designs conveyed lineage and status. Modern forearm ink often blends traditional motifs with personal symbolism—whether honoring ancestors, celebrating resilience, or marking a defining life event, these tattoos carry stories etched in skin.

From the Ankh representing eternal life to Celtic knots symbolizing interconnectedness, forearm tattoos offer rich visual language. Animals like wolves embody loyalty, while lotus flowers signify rebirth. Incorporating dates, quotes, or sacred geometry adds layers of personal meaning, transforming ink into a visual diary of one’s journey.

The forearm’s visibility enhances the impact of tattoos, but placement affects longevity and style. A full forearm allows intricate designs, while a smaller segment suits minimalist symbols. Consulting a skilled artist ensures proper sizing, shading, and placement that complements body contours, preserving clarity and meaning for years.
